India, one of the best places to visit in January, is diverse culturally, architecturally, geographically and what not! Discover it all as you tour cities, towns and other hotspots. Taj Mahal, the symbol of love, must top your travel itinerary. The weather is cooler and the sight is exceptionally remarkable. This is also the peak tourist season, so expect some crowd. Indian destinations such as Zanskar (Jammu and Kashmir), Auli (Uttarakhand), Delhi and Jaipur (Rajasthan) are perfect for your January visit. Zanskar showcases the walkable frozen Zanskar River, Auli provides skiing opportunities, Delhi offers a national carnival and vibrant festivals, and Jaipur brings to you Jaipur Literature Festival along with imposing forts and palaces in the month of January.

Georgia, the pretty little Caucasian country is one of the best winter destinations in Europe. It experiences cold weather conditions with temperature falling below 10 degrees Celsius in January. Snow is a common feature and winter activities like skiing take place in full swing! Gudauri, the world-renowned ski resort, located at the altitude of 3,000 metres on the southern slopes of the Lesser Caucuses range is buzzing with tourists and lots of skiing action. You can go for a winter trek from the tiny town of Kazbegi (now known as Stepandsminda) up the snow-clad mountains to reach the Gergeti Trinity Church – among world’s most beautiful churches! At the end of this 2-3 hour trek, you’ll be greated with sweeping views of the snow-clad region!

Christmas in Georgia is celebrated on 7th January (and not 25th December) as Georgians follow the Julian calendar. The Christmas morning of a Georgian Christmas starts with a march called ‘Alio’ by hundreds of revelers after morning mass. Carrying their national flag and dressing up as characters from famous Christmas tales, Georgians sing beautiful hymns and carols and are always in very fine voice. Seeing the streets of Tbilisi filled with people on Christmas morning is truly a sight that must be witnessed at least once in your life!

Jordan witnesses cold climate in January with temperature ranging from 5°C to 10°C. This is the best time to go hiking in Jordan, even on desert trails as the weather is pleasantly cool. Take the National Geographic-acclaimed route from Little Petra to Petra! Step into the centrally-heated museums and churches – La Storia is a must among them. If you prefer a warmer destination within Jordan, head to the Dead Sea area for some good ol’ relaxation and rejuvenate your tired body amidst the mineral-rich sea water and detoxifying mud of the Dead Sea!
